Scuba Diving: Where Wonders Await Below

Jumping into Andaman’s crystal-clear waters feels like entering a surreal underwater world. The coral reefs here teem with vibrant fish, mysterious sea creatures, and kaleidoscopic corals. Scuba diving isn’t just for pros—trained instructors are always by your side, making this adventure accessible even for first-timers or non-swimmers.

Why Try Scuba Diving in Andaman?

·        Explore world-class dive sites in Havelock (Swaraj Dweep), Neil (Shaheed Dweep), and Port Blair.

·        Spot majestic creatures like manta rays, sea turtles, and schools of colorful fish.

·        Diving is safe and well-regulated with professional support for beginners and experts alike.

Snorkel in Andaman

Prefer staying closer to the surface? Snorkeling offers a mesmerizing peek into the Andaman’s marine life. Simply pop on a mask, grab your fins, and glide over coral gardens just a few meters from the shore.

Where to Snorkel in Andaman

·        North Bay Island: Famous for accessible reefs and glass-bottom boat rides.

·        Elephant Beach, Havelock: Known for abundant coral and gentle waters.

·        Neil Island: Offers vibrant underwater life in shallow lagoons.

Snorkeling is ideal for families, inexperienced swimmers, and anyone curious to see marine life up close.

Sea Walking: Walk with the Fishes

Ever wondered how it feels to walk on the ocean bed? Sea walking lets you don a specialized helmet for underwater breathing, then stroll among colorful fish and corals—no swimming skills needed.

What Makes Sea Walking Special?

·        Available mainly at North Bay Island and Elephant Beach.

·        Perfect for non-swimmers.

·        Safe, guided, and utterly unique—keep your glasses or contacts on, and even your hair stays dry!

Parasailing: Take Flight Above the Sea

If you want a mix of ocean and air, parasailing is the ultimate thrill. Harnessed to a parachute and towed by a speedboat, you’ll soar high above the Bay of Bengal, with the wind in your hair and dazzling panoramas stretching as far as the eye can see.

Top Spots for Parasailing

·        Rajiv Gandhi Water Sports Complex at Port Blair is the prime spot.

·        Also available at Havelock Island.

Jet Skiing and Speed Boating: Pure Adrenaline Rush

Craving test-the-limits speed? Jet skiing and speed boating will get your pulse racing as you zoom across sparkling waves, splash through sea spray, and experience the islands’ energy in a totally different way.

Where to Ride

·        Corbyn’s Cove Beach, Port Blair: Jet skiing hotspot.

·        Havelock and Neil Islands: Popular with both beginners and seasoned enthusiasts.

These activities combine the thrill of speed with unbeatable Andaman scenery, making for unforgettable videos and memories.

Kayaking: Paddle Into the Mangroves

For those who love adventure blended with serenity, kayaking in Andaman is an absolute must. Glide quietly through tangled mangrove creeks, explore mysterious lagoons, and listen to the call of exotic birds. Night kayaking for bioluminescence is a once-in-a-lifetime experience.

Best Places for Kayaking

·        Havelock and Neil Islands: Beautiful mangrove lanes and calm waterways.

·        Baratang Island: Stunning, off-the-beaten-track mangrove explorations.

Game Fishing & Sport Angling: Hook the Big One

If you dream of wrestling the deep, Andaman’s sport fishing scene is world-renowned. Catch marlin, tuna, barracuda, and more just a short ride from shore. Trips are available for all levels—with or without experience—and gear is provided.

Safety First: Tips for Enjoying Andaman Water Sports

·        Always listen carefully to instructors and safety briefings.

·        Wear life jackets or appropriate safety gear as advised.

·        Book with government-recognized or certified operators for trustworthy standards.

·        Check the weather forecast before booking—monsoons can affect activity availability.

·        Respect local guidelines, especially in protected areas and around wildlife.
